Ionia Homes and Why They Get Dirty Fast
Ionia sits along the Grand River in west-central Michigan. Winters here are long and wet. Homes accumulate road salt tracked in from driveways and garages all the way through March.
Spring brings heavy pollen from the mature oaks, maples, and cottonwoods throughout the city. That pollen settles on every surface. It works into carpet fibers and onto window sills fast.
Summer humidity along the river corridor encourages mold and mildew, especially in older homes near downtown Ionia. Many houses in that area were built before World War II. They have original woodwork, plaster walls, and older ventilation. Moisture lingers longer in those structures.
Neighborhoods like the historic districts around Washington Street and the residential streets south of Main Street feature older single-family homes on modest lots. Homes closer to the fairgrounds area tend to see heavier foot traffic and surface dust, especially during the Ionia Free Fair each summer.
New construction on the edges of the city brings post-build dust and drywall grit. Those homes need a thorough clean before anyone moves in. Ionia's mix of housing stock — historic downtown homes, mid-century ranches, and newer builds — means cleaning needs vary a lot from block to block.

Standard, Deep, Move-Out & Post-Construction Cleaning in Ionia
Not every clean is the same job. Here is the honest difference, from cleaners who do this every day:
- Standard clean — your regular upkeep: kitchen surfaces, appliance fronts, stovetop and sink, bathrooms fully wiped and disinfected, floors swept and mopped, dusting, vacuuming, and trash taken out. Best on a home that is already maintained.
- Deep clean — everything in a standard clean, plus the detail work: baseboards, window sills, blinds dusted, hard-water buildup on faucets, shower doors and grout scrubbed, ceiling fans, inside the microwave, and (on request) inside the fridge and oven. This is what a first-time or long-overdue clean needs.
- Move-out clean — the same deep-clean detail on an empty home, aimed at getting your deposit back: empty cabinets, inside appliances, window tracks, and baseboards.
- Post-construction clean — after a remodel or new build, when fine drywall dust coats everything. A careful wall-to-floor process, priced for the extra work.

How House Cleaning Is Priced in Ionia
Honest pricing depends on the size and condition of your home, not a flat guess. Bigger homes and deeper cleans take longer, and a well-maintained place on a recurring plan costs less per visit than a first-time deep clean. You get a clear estimate up front.
What makes a clean take longer (and cost more): a home that has never had a professional clean, pets — especially on carpet, small children, and heavy clutter. We factor these in honestly instead of lowballing and then upcharging on the day.
Rough time on site: a standard clean usually runs 2 to 3½ hours; a deep or move-out clean 4½ to 6½ hours; post-construction longer. That way you can plan your day.
Supplies: our pros bring their own professional-grade supplies and equipment. Prefer a specific product for a certain surface? Leave it out and we will use it.
